The law firm of Peters, Habib, McKenna, Juhl-Rhodes & Cardoza, LLP can trace its history as far back as the 1800's when Guy R. Kennedy, a nephew of Annie and General Bidwell, began developing Chico. Sometime after Mr. Kennedy established his practice in approximately 1896, Jerome Peters, Sr. joined Mr. Kennedy in the practice of law, followed by his son, Jerome Peters, Jr. Areas of the firm’s practice now extend to all of Northern California. Emphasis is placed on a broad range of litigation matters and legal representation. The firm encourages active community involvement by its members in civic and professional activities.
